Introduction: In recent years, many countries in Africa have been grappling with Hyperinflation, a situation where prices of goods and services skyrocket, and the value of the local currency plunges. This hyperinflationary environment poses significant challenges for businesses operating in these regions, requiring them to adapt their Business planning strategies to survive and thrive in such conditions. Understanding Hyperinflation in Africa: Hyperinflation in Africa is often fueled by a variety of factors, including economic instability, political unrest, corruption, and external shocks such as fluctuations in global commodity prices. Countries like Zimbabwe, Venezuela, and South Sudan have all experienced hyperinflation leading to severe economic hardships for businesses and individuals alike. Impact on Businesses: For businesses operating in hyperinflationary environments in Africa, the challenges are multidimensional. Rising costs of raw materials, fluctuating exchange rates, unpredictable consumer demand, and difficulties in accessing credit are some of the key issues they face. Additionally, business planning becomes incredibly difficult as traditional forecasting methods become unreliable in such volatile conditions. Strategies for Business Planning in Hyperinflationary Environments: Despite the challenges posed by hyperinflation, businesses in Africa can adopt several strategies to navigate these turbulent times and ensure their sustainability. Some of these strategies include: 1. Flexible Pricing: Businesses need to adapt quickly to changing market conditions by implementing flexible pricing policies that account for rapid price fluctuations. 2. Diversification: Diversifying product offerings and revenue streams can help businesses spread their risk and mitigate the impact of hyperinflation on their operations. 3. Cost Management: Tight cost control measures, including renegotiating supplier contracts, optimizing inventory levels, and reducing unnecessary expenses, are crucial for businesses to maintain profitability. 4. Currency Hedging: Businesses can consider using financial instruments such as currency hedging to mitigate the impact of exchange rate volatility on their bottom line. 5. Scenario Planning: Given the uncertainty surrounding hyperinflation, businesses should engage in scenario planning to develop multiple business plans based on different inflationary scenarios and adjust their strategies accordingly. Conclusion: In conclusion, hyperinflation in Africa presents significant challenges for businesses, requiring them to rethink their traditional business planning approaches. By adopting flexible strategies, diversifying revenue streams, managing costs effectively, and engaging in scenario planning, businesses can better navigate the complexities of hyperinflation and position themselves for long-term success in the face of economic volatility.
